Step 1
In food processor, pulse fruit, occasionally scraping side of bowl, until finely chopped and fluffy. Add sweetened condensed milk, honey, and 1/2 teaspoon salt; pulse, occasionally scraping side of bowl, until smooth and whirring around blade in continuous wave.
Step 2
Transfer mixture to 5- by 9-inch loaf pan. Freeze, uncovered, until set, about 4 hours. Serve or cover tightly with plastic wrap and freeze for up to 2 weeks. Makes about 5 cups.
Step 3
In large bowl, using electric mixer with whisk attachment, beat cream until stiff peaks form.
Step 4
Meanwhile, in second large bowl, whisk together sweetened condensed milk, coconut milk, and 1/2 teaspoon salt. Whisk in 1 cup whipped cream to combine, then fold in remaining whipped cream.
Step 5
Transfer mixture to 5- by 9-inch loaf pan. Freeze, uncovered, until set, about 4 hours. Serve or cover tightly with plastic wrap and freeze for up to 2 weeks. Makes about 6 cups.
